| The Tang Dynasty built a huge post system.The post roads connected all the territory of the Tang empire and communicated with the outside world.The post system in the Tang Dynasty included two parts:official post and private post Private post developed rapidly under the background of social prosperity.With the rise of the imperial examination system and commerce,private post reached its peak.This article is based on official mail.In the Tang Dynasty,the official post was responsible for the transfer of official documents,beacon fire communication,official travel reception,assisting special officials to take office,places for nobles to die,customs fortress and material transportation,etc.In order to ensure the safety and efficiency of the official post,the Tang Dynasty established a strict post management system.The organization,administrative level and personnel configuration of post were customized.In the post,there are clear norms for the illegal behaviors such as the post records and official documents leaks.The post system of the Tang Dynasty played an important role in the transmission of central and local information,the normal operation of the imperial politics and economy,the security of the border areas and the promotion of cultural exchanges at home and abroad.However,after the rebellion of An Lushan Rebellion,the post system and its disadvantages gradually became obvious.Due to the lack of post horses and the disorder of system implementation,a large number of post stations and post roads were abandoned and officials abused the popularity of post.The post industry in the Tang Dynasty eventually declined. |
